Actually, you are wrong. Disney BOUGHT the Muppets in 2004, with the exception of the Fraggles and the Sesame Street Characters. With the exception of those characters and the original ones from the show, Jim Henson Company characters cannot even be CALLED Muppets without Disney’s permission. Last fall I WORKED with folks from The Jim Henson Company on a show and was corrected every time I called them Muppets, even though they were characters created by Jim Henson over 30 years ago.
From the Dec. 3, 2009 Wall Street Journal: “Walt Disney Co. has quietly found a way to inject a little cooperation into its operations—combining two of its most iconic, if culturally disparate, properties: the Muppets and Queen. The Burbank, Calif., entertainment giant bought the Muppets from the Jim Henson Co. in 2004, and now it is in the process of relaunching the fuzzy-puppet franchise in the run up to a coming feature film (release TBA)…”
